Building Decks That Hold Up in Obstruction Pass
Obstruction Pass sits on the wooded, water-facing side of Orcas Island, and that location shapes almost every decision that goes into a good deck here. Salt air off the water accelerates corrosion on fasteners and hardware. Driving rain off Rosario Strait finds every gap in flashing and framing. And the tree cover that makes this part of San Juan County so beautiful also means shade, damp air, and a moss season that can run most of the year. A deck built to a generic spec sheet does not last long under those conditions. A deck built for this specific stretch of Orcas Island does.

What Makes Obstruction Pass Different From an Inland Build
Decks on this side of the island deal with a combination of stressors that inland lots on Orcas rarely see all at once:
- Salt-laden air that speeds up corrosion on screws, brackets, post bases, and railing hardware — even hardware rated for exterior use can fail early if it is not rated for coastal exposure.
- Persistent shade from conifer cover, which keeps decking damp longer after rain and creates ideal conditions for moss, algae, and mildew.
- Wind-driven rain that gets pushed sideways under railings and against ledger connections, rather than simply falling straight down.
- Narrow, sometimes steep access roads typical of the waterfront and wooded lots in this area, which affect how materials are staged and how equipment gets to the build site.
- Soil and drainage conditions near the shoreline that need to be accounted for in footing depth and placement.
None of these individually is unusual for the San Juan Islands. Together, on a single lot, they mean a deck needs to be treated as a coastal structure, not a standard backyard addition.
Where Decks Actually Fail First
The Ledger Connection
The point where a deck attaches to the house is the single most common failure point we see on older decks around Orcas Island. If the ledger board was not properly flashed and sealed when it was installed, water works its way behind it over years, rotting the rim joist and, eventually, the framing inside the wall. In a high-rainfall, tree-shaded spot like Obstruction Pass, an unflashed or poorly flashed ledger can fail years before the decking on top even shows wear.
Fasteners and Hardware
Standard exterior-rated screws and joist hangers are not the same as coastal-rated hardware. Near salt water, even galvanized fasteners can start showing rust streaks and pitting within a few seasons. We use stainless steel or coastal-rated fasteners and connectors on every project in this area — it costs more up front and saves a rebuild later.
Substructure Airflow
Decks built low to the ground or over damp, shaded soil without adequate ventilation trap moisture underneath. That moisture feeds rot in the joists and encourages moss and algae growth on the underside of the decking, which most homeowners never see until it is a structural problem.
Choosing a Decking Material for This Climate
There is no single "best" decking material — there is a best material for a given lot, budget, and how much maintenance a homeowner actually wants to do. In a shaded, salt-air, high-moisture environment like Obstruction Pass, here is how the common choices actually perform:
| Material | Moisture & Moss Resistance | Maintenance | Typical Lifespan Here |
|---|---|---|---|
| Pressure-treated wood | Fair — needs sealing to resist moisture and slow moss growth | Annual cleaning, re-sealing every 1-2 years | 10-15 years with upkeep |
| Cedar | Good natural rot resistance, but still absorbs moisture in shade | Regular cleaning and periodic oiling to prevent graying and moss | 15-20 years with upkeep |
| Capped composite | Excellent — resists moisture absorption and won't rot | Occasional washing to clear moss and pollen film | 25+ years, backed by manufacturer warranty |
| Uncapped composite | Good, but the exposed core can hold moisture over time | More frequent cleaning than capped composite | 15-25 years |
| Tropical hardwood (e.g., ipe) | Very good natural density and rot resistance | Periodic oiling to maintain color; can be slippery when mossy | 25+ years |
For shaded, moss-prone lots, we generally steer homeowners away from uncapped or budget composite products — the exposed cores can wick moisture in exactly the conditions Obstruction Pass sees for much of the year. Capped composite or a well-maintained cedar deck tend to be the more honest long-term choices, depending on budget and the look you want.
Our Process for a Custom Deck Build
1. Site Visit and Design
We walk the property with you, look at sun and shade exposure, drainage, existing structure (for attached decks), and access for equipment and materials — access matters more on some Obstruction Pass lots than it would on a flat, road-front property elsewhere on Orcas Island. We talk through material options honestly, including trade-offs in cost, maintenance, and how each will hold up given the specific shade and moisture profile of your lot.
2. Permitting
Most new decks and many significant deck rebuilds in San Juan County require a building permit, and shoreline-proximity lots can involve additional review. We handle the permitting process as part of the job so you are not left navigating county requirements on your own.
3. Framing and Flashing
This is where the long-term durability of the deck actually gets decided. Proper ledger flashing, coastal-rated fasteners, correctly spaced and sized joists, and adequate ground clearance for airflow all happen at this stage — before a single decking board goes down.
4. Decking, Railing, and Finish Work
Decking is installed with attention to drainage and gap spacing so water and debris don't pool. Railings are set with hardware rated for salt-air exposure. Stairs, lighting, and any built-in features are finished last.
5. Final Walkthrough
We walk the finished deck with you, explain what maintenance it will need and roughly when, and answer questions before we consider the job done.
Railings and Hardware Built for Salt Air
Railings take a lot of abuse near the water — they're touched constantly, exposed directly to wind-driven rain, and often the first thing to show corrosion. We spec stainless steel or coated hardware rated for coastal environments on railing posts, brackets, and cable or baluster connections. Cheaper zinc-plated hardware may look fine for a season or two before rust starts bleeding through the finish, which on a light-colored deck or railing is one of the most common complaints we hear from homeowners who had work done elsewhere.
Living With a Long Moss Season
Moss and algae growth on a shaded, damp deck in this part of Orcas Island isn't a sign of a bad build — it's a normal part of owning a deck under tree cover near the water. What matters is staying ahead of it so it does not become a slip hazard or trap moisture against the decking surface. A simple, realistic maintenance routine goes a long way:
- Sweep debris (needles, leaves, pollen) off the deck regularly — this is what feeds moss growth more than anything else
- Wash the deck surface at least once or twice a year with a deck-safe cleaner, more often in heavily shaded spots
- Keep an eye on the underside and framing where visible — early moss or dark staining there is worth a look before it spreads
- Trim back overhanging branches where possible to let more light and airflow reach the deck surface
- Reseal wood decking on the schedule appropriate to the product — don't wait until it looks obviously weathered
- Check railing hardware annually for early rust streaks, which are easier to address early than after they've stained the surface
Composite decking cuts down on several of these tasks but does not eliminate moss and algae entirely in a shaded, high-moisture spot — regular washing is still the best defense regardless of material.
Permits and San Juan County Considerations
San Juan County generally requires permits for new deck construction and for major rebuilds, and lots near the shoreline can be subject to additional setback or critical-areas review. Requirements vary by parcel, so we don't guess — we confirm what applies to your specific property as part of the design process and handle the paperwork so the project stays on track.
